About 751 30th St NE

This charming 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ath home offers both comfort and convenience. The spacious eat-in kitchen features granite countertops, a large center island bar, tile flooring, and opens to a generous deck, wood privacy-fenced large back yard with plenty of space to relax or play. The living room boasts beautiful hardwood floors and a cozy gas fireplace. Upstairs, the spacious master suite includes new carpet, dual closets, and a master bath with double sinks. The finished lower level adds even more living space with a comfortable family room, 1/2 bath, and a versatile bonus room—ideal for an office, gym, or guest area. Attached 2-stall garage completes the package. A wonderful home in a prime location near Collins.

Living in Cedar Rapids, IA

Cedar Rapids provides a variety of transportation options for its residents. The public transit system offers bus services connecting different parts of the city, with schedules designed to accommodate commuters and local travelers. While specific ride-sharing services are available, their names are not mentioned here. The city is also equipped with a network of roads and highways that facilitate easy commuting and travel to neighboring areas. Efforts have been made to enhance the walkability and bikeability in certain districts, promoting a more pedestrian-friendly environment.

The community is served by a comprehensive educational system, including numerous public schools at the elementary, middle, and high school levels, as well as private educational institutions. Cedar Rapids is home to several healthcare facilities offering a range of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The city also features a public library system that supports the educational and informational needs of its residents. Retail and dining options are plentiful, with local establishments reflecting the culinary diversity and culture of the area.

Cedar Rapids is celebrated for its vibrant arts scene and community-oriented atmosphere. The city prides itself on annual events like the Cedar Rapids Freedom Festival, which fosters a sense of community and patriotism. The downtown area is known for its cultural venues and public art installations, contributing to the city's unique character and charm.

Cedar Rapids offers a diverse housing market with a blend of architectural styles, including classic ranch, craftsman, and contemporary homes. The housing landscape is primarily composed of single-family homes, which make up a significant portion of the market. There is also a selection of apartments and townhouses available, catering to a range of living preferences. The homeownership rate in Cedar Rapids is robust, with a majority of residents owning their homes, while a smaller percentage are renting.
